Since commit 696453e66630ad45 ("mm, oom: task_will_free_mem should skip oom_reaped tasks") changed task_will_free_mem(current) in out_of_memory() to return false as soon as MMF_OOM_SKIP is set, many threads sharing the victim's mm were not able to try allocation from memory reserves after the OOM reaper gave up reclaiming memory. Therefore, this patch allows OOM victims to use ALLOC_OOM watermark for last second allocation attempt.
